First clinical success! Yuanhua Tech, with its orthopaedic surgical robot with originally developed HX Orthopaedic-Specific Robotic Arm, breaks into the high-end medical equipment market

HONG KONG, Feb. 12, 2026 -- On February 11, the orthopaedic surgical robot with originally developed HX Orthopaedic-Specific Robotic Arm, which was 100% homemade by Yuanhua Robotics, Perception and AI Technologies Ltd. (hereinafter referred to as "Yuanhua Tech"), saw its first clinical success at West China Hospital of Sichuan University.

 

This milestone achievement signifies that the domestically produced high-end surgical robot has successfully passed the clinical verification of a top medical institution in the field of self-developed key execution components. It has injected new momentum into Yuanhua Tech's leadership in the field of high-end specialized medical equipment made in China, and has once again confirmed the broad prospects of domestic substitution.

 

Full-chain self-developed key technologies forging a path of independent control

 

Founded in Shenzhen in 2018, Yuanhua Tech focuses on the research and development and intelligent manufacturing of high-end specialized intelligent medical equipment. It is the only company in China that has achieved independent development of all key components for orthopaedic surgical robots. Since its inception, the company has aimed at domestic substitution, adhered to the path of independent technology, and successfully broken the international monopoly on key components of high-end surgical robots, solving the "bottleneck" problem of the domestic industry's long-term reliance on imports.

 

Upon two years of technological breakthroughs, Yuanhua Orthopaedic Robotics (Shenzhen) Co., Ltd., one of Yuanhua Tech's wholly-owned subsidiaries, has developed the nation's first orthopaedic surgical robot with 100% originally developed HX Orthopaedic-Specific Robotic Arm designed for orthopaedic surgery applications. This "Made in China" tool has achieved breakthroughs in key technologies such as high-precision zero-gravity compensation, compliant control, and tactile feedback, marking a historic leap forward in achieving full-chain independent control over the key execution components of domestically produced high-end surgical robots.

 

Based on the concept of medical-engineering integration, the orthopaedic surgical robot with originally developed HX Orthopaedic-Specific Robotic Arm achieves a human-machine collaborative surgical experience where surgeons control the robotic arm as if they were using their own arm. With its stable performance of zero lag, zero latency, zero deviation, and zero error, the surgical robot significantly improves surgical efficiency and accuracy; while its underlying architecture, which is deeply based on the Chinese anatomical database, ensures clinical adaptability and medical data security from the source.

A multi-departmental ecosystem with through-life solutions is being built, and challenging clinical applications demonstrate the core value of this ecosystem

 

Driven by core products such as the orthopaedic surgical robot with originally developed HX Orthopaedic-Specific Robotic Arm and the KUNWU® 5-in-1 Robotic Orthopaedic Surgical Systems, Yuanhua Tech has built a product portfolio of advanced specialized surgical robots covering multiple departments such as orthopaedics, gastroenterology, obstetrics and gynecology, and hemodialysis centers, with the orthopaedic surgical robots as the leading products. Also, it is able to provide a full range of products across preoperative planning, intraoperative navigation, consumable matching and postoperative rehabilitation, offering integrated solutions of high-end specialized medical equipment.

 

By 2025, Yuanhua Tech had had 12 products certified by the National Medical Products Administration (NMPA), covering four major product segments, demonstrating its continued R&D and transformation capabilities.

 

So far, the clinical value of Yuanhua Tech's products has been proven in multiple scenarios. Its KUNWU® Robotic Orthopaedic Surgical Systems assisted a Hong Kong medical institution in completing the world's first complex robot-assisted hip replacement surgery; and the first clinical application of the orthopaedic surgical robot with originally developed HX Orthopaedic-Specific Robotic Arm at West China Hospital of Sichuan University brings the clinical validation of the company's core products to a new level and helps accumulate key real-world data for the large-scale application of the products.

 

On the commercial front, Yuanhua Tech is accelerating the internationalization of its products. It has received product licenses in countries such as Brazil, Indonesia, Thailand, and Malaysia, and gained access to key markets such as Southeast Asia and South America, becoming one of the few Chinese companies to export homemade high-end surgical robots.
